My MGP is on the topic All About Me. For this topic I thought I would simply write a letter of introduction to my students parents. It will look something like this....
Dear Parents:
I want to extend my warmest welcome to your child into our classroom. My name is Mrs. Angelica Guerra and I will be your son/daughter's first grade teacher. I have a BAS in Interdisciplinary Studies in EC-6th grade from Texas A&M University and an AAS in Early Childhood from San Antonio College. I have thirteen years teaching work experience with children ages 3-5years.
I will be working with the class during the first week of school to come up with a set of classroom expectations (rules). We will spend this week getting to know each other and how we can make this a fun learning environment. I will also be sending weekly newsletters that will inform you the topics and events taking place not only in our classroom but the school as well.
My philosophy for learning is that each child is unique, and each child learns in a different way. One of my jobs as a teacher is to help your child discover his or her individuality and work alongside with them to maximize it. I believe in hands-on experiences, learning creatively and learning though play. I am really looking forward to a fun–filled and educational year!
Attached to this page you will find a list of things your child will need when we start classes. If you need have any questions please feel free to contact me.
